Kenya's automotive industry is poised to expand throughout the continent

The automotive sector in Kenya has seen a significant increase in local automobile sales as a result of President Uhuru Kenyatta's decree given in 2019 pushing all government departments to buy locally produced cars in an effort to further the objective of the 'Buy Kenya Build Kenya' campaign.Under President Kenyatta's Big 4 Economic Agenda, the government put aside cash last year to purchase automobiles from local assemblers as part of an economic stimulus package. Google to invest $1 billion in Africa over the next five years

Google announced a $1 billion investment over the next five years to enable faster and more affordable internet access and to boost entrepreneurship in Africa. According to the World Bank, fewer than one-third of the continent's 1.3 billion inhabitants are linked to broadband. Kenya: Sanergy receives $2.5 million for fertiliser and protein production.

A new investor is interested in Sanergy. The U.S. Company is promoting an innovative approach to the circular economy in developing countries, including Kenya. The Japan International Cooperation Agency (Jica) is investing $2.5 million in Sanergy’s capital. This equity investment will enable Sanergy to provide more fertilizer for agriculture and insect protein for animal feed.
